How does CBD oil help PTSD? 

Post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D) can be an alarming experience. But CBD could help manage PTSD symptoms. 

According to the journal Frontiers in Neuroscience, “This disorder affects approximately 10% of people at some point in life”. It can manifest differently between people, with sleep issues, depression, anxiety, flashbacks, and avoiding certain places, people or things that remind you of a traumatic time. 

Before we discuss CBD, we must stress the importance of speaking to a health care provider or mental health professional (i.e. psychotherapist) if you’re struggling with emotional health. Consulting with a health professional can contribute to your physical and mental recovery, especially when you learn coping strategies. 

For extra support to help alleviate PTSD, cannabidiol (CBD) could offer benefits. The endocannabinoid system (ECS) modulates a range of processes, including mood. When CBD is taken, it could trigger ECS receptors to promote calmness. CBN (cannabinol) may also help improve sleep due to its sedating effects. And, if you’re struggling with eating regularly due to PTSD, CBN may work as an appetite stimulant.

FYI: CBD and other cannabinoids can interact with some medications. Please consult with your medical doctor or pharmacist to rule out these interactions prior to using CBD and CBN.
